For AI/coding-agent products, I would separate this into two problems. First: abuse control without killing real onboarding. I would avoid putting every new user through heavy friction immediately. Start with softer controls like email verification, per-account compute/workspace limits, rate limits by IP/device/email domain/OAuth identity, delayed access to expensive model actions, and suspicious-signup queues instead of hard blocks. Second: cost and trust boundaries. If the product can trigger Claude/OpenCode runs, the abuse surface is not just spam accounts. It is compute spend, repo access, prompt injection, and tool misuse. I would make the default new account sandboxed until it has a small amount of trusted activity. The metrics I would watch: signup to first successful run, first-run cost, accounts per IP/device/domain, failed auth or repeated workspace creation, model/tool calls per new account, and support tickets from legitimate users blocked by controls. The mistake is reacting with one giant wall: mandatory waitlists, heavy KYC, or broad bans. That protects cost but kills learning. A better early-stage setup is progressive trust: low-friction signup, low initial limits, higher limits after verified usage, manual review only for suspicious patterns, and clear audit logs for every expensive or external action. If you keep the first 200 real users moving while making bots uneconomical, you turn the abuse event into a reliability milestone instead of just a fire drill.

If the behavioral analysis incorrectly flags authentic early adopters, it kills user acquisition at the most critical stage.
If the SDK takes more than a few minutes to configure, busy indie builders will fallback to manual post-launch triage.
AI-driven or human-in-the-loop bots might bypass simple heuristics, requiring advanced fingerprinting mechanics.
